The Indoor Environment & Energy Efficiency Association in Va. honored Brian Hooper with the 2015 Skip Snyder Humanitarian Award for his leadership as president and co-founder of Building Dreams for Marines in Nashua. Hooper is VP of MSI Mechanical Systems in Salem and a 2013 Business NH Magazine Business Leader of the Year.

Rivier University in Nashua awarded Karen Daley an honorary doctorate of humane letters to recognize her work as nurse, public health advocate and educator.

The Greater Manchester Chamber of Commerce in Manchester awarded Ellie Cochran, retired, its 2015 Citizen of the Year award for her lifelong commitment to philanthropy and giving back to NH.

The HNH Foundation in Concord elected three members to its board of directors: Pamela Brown, founder and president of Brown Performance Group in Central Harbor; Kathleen Mongan Thies, faculty at the department of nursing at the University of NH in Durham; and John Hunt, NH State Representative in Concord.

Autofair Automotive Group in Manchester donated $50,000 to Families in Transition in Manchester to support construction of its family shelter and resource center on Lake Avenue in Manchester.

Homewood Suites by Hilton Gateway Hills in Nashua opened its pre-opening office down the street from the under-construction hotel. It also named Adam Robitaille as general manager, former director of sales and marketing at Hilton Hotels Worldwide in Mass., and Jayme Putnam as sales manager, former director of sales at Fairfield Inn by Marriott Boston Manchester Regional Airport in Manchester.
